What are the differences between infarction and gangrene?

A doctor has provided 1 answer

Good question: When blood supply is interrupted the segment tissue that receives blood will die scar tissue will fill the gap as seen in heart attach myocardial infraction. ( heart attack ) , in gangrene initial stages same tissue necrosis or death tissue occurs , then get infected as seen in lower extremities and bowel etc.
